Step-by-step explanation:

Given:

x + y = 25 ---(1)

50x + 100y = 2000 ---(2)

To Find:

The value of x and y

You Should know:

As you asked "how can we solve it by using substitution method".

1st You have to know Substitution Method,

Substitution method is just like it's name 1st solve any easy equation and take y alone or x alone.

2nd Plug in the value of x or y in unsolved equation. 3rd Simplify till answer and vice versa.

Solution:

Solving (1)

x + y = 25

or, x = 25 - y

Now, Plugin the value of x in equn. (2)

50x + 100y = 200

or,50(x + 2y) = 2000

or, x + 2y = 40

or, 25 - y + 2y = 40

or, y = 40 - 25

or, y = 15

So, x = 25 - y

= 25 - 15

= 10

Therefore, The required value of x = 10 and y = 15
